  • Kitchen & Bath Remodel in Winter: Ventilation, Layout, and Waterproofing That Actually Performs

A great remodel isn’t just new finishes—it’s a kitchen and bath that works better every day. In winter, Philadelphia homeowners feel what doesn’t work: cold floors, foggy mirrors, weak exhaust, and layouts that feel cramped when everyone’s inside more often.

If you’re researching a kitchen remodeler or bathroom remodel in Philadelphia, start with performance planning: airflow, lighting, storage, and proper waterproofing. Winter is ideal because problems are easier to detect—humidity, condensation, and venting issues don’t hide.

What we prioritize before design decisions lock in

1) Function-first kitchen layout
We plan landing zones, prep flow, appliance clearances, and traffic paths so your kitchen feels bigger—without adding square footage.

2) Bathroom ventilation done correctly
A fan that vents incorrectly (or barely vents at all) leads to peeling paint, mold risk, and grout issues. We plan proper ducting and airflow.

3) Waterproofing systems (not “tile is waterproof”)
Tile and grout are not the waterproof layer. We plan the right membrane/waterproofing approach and build it clean.

4) Substrate prep so tile lasts
Many tile failures are substrate failures. We plan backer systems, leveling, and movement control so finishes stay tight.

5) Materials and lead-time planning
Cabinets, quartz, tile, and fixtures can delay the whole job if selected late. We lock key choices early to protect install dates.

Winter planning = fewer surprises, better sequencing, and a remodel that looks premium and performs.
